Total mercury (THg) concentrations were measured for various fish species from Lakes Turkana, Naivasha and Baringo in the rift valley of Kenya. The highest THg concentration (636 ng g(-1) wet weight) was measured for a piscivorous tigerfish Hydrocynus forskahlii from Lake Turkana. THg concentrations for the Perciformes species, the Nile perch Lates niloticus from Lake Turkana and the largemouth bass Micropterus salmoides from Lake Naivasha ranged between 4 and 95 ng g(-1). The tilapiine species in all lakes, including the Nile tilapia Oreochromis niloticus, had consistently low THg concentrations ranging between 2 and 25 ng g(-1). In Lake Naivasha, the crayfish species, Procambrus clarkii, had THg concentrations similar to those for the tilapiine species from the same lake, which is consistent with their shared detritivore diet. THg concentrations in all fish species were usually consistent with their known trophic position, with highest concentrations in piscivores and declining in omnivores, insectivores and detritivores. One exception is the detritivore Labeo cylindricus from Lake Baringo, which had surprisingly elevated THg concentrations (mean=75 ng g(-1)), which was similar to those for the top trophic species (Clarias and Protopterus) in the same lake. Except for two Hydrocynus forskahlii individuals from Lake Turkana, which had THg concentrations near or above the international marketing limit of 500 ng g(-1), THg concentrations in the fish were generally below those of World Health Organization's recommended limit of 200 ng g(-1) for at-risk groups.  相似文献

On the English and French Channel coasts, the dog-whelk Nucella lapilus (L.) exhibits variation in chromosome number which appears to correlate with the degree of wave action on the shore. The more common, 2n=26 morph is typically found on exposed shores subjected to a high degree of wave action, whereas those with higher chromosome numbers, up to the recorded maximum of 2n=36, are restricted to more sheltered environments. The polymorphism is thought to be Robertsonian in nature, involving centric (centromere) fission or fusion, but detailed analysis of the polymorphism has been restricted by lack of success in labelling individual chromosomes. Using a silver-staining technique for the nucleolar organiser regions (NORs), three pairs of chromosomes, in the basic 2n=26 karyotype, have been positively identified. A series of structural chromosomal rearrangements (pericentric and paracentric inversions) affecting one pair of chromosomes involved in the numerical polymorphism is described. Significant differences exist between populations with respect to this character. These chromosomal rearrangements have the potential to reduce the level of interbreeding between the different types, and may act as isolating mechamisms between breeding groups. Structural chromosomal polymorphism is likely, therefore, to have greater significance in relation to adaptation than simple numerical variation. This finding raises important questions concerning the (cyto)taxonomic status of N. lapillus in different parts of its range.  相似文献

There are important linkages between the health of humans and theenvironment, restoration of degraded lands, and long-term stewardship of public lands, yet most environmental indicators deal only with assessing the physical and biological aspects ofecosystems. In this article, we examine the ratings of perceptionsof several environmental problems for their utility as indicatorsof environmental quality, and examine perceptions of future land use by people interviewed in Santa Fe, New Mexico, near the Department of Energy's (DOE) Los Alamos National Laboratory (LANL). Overall, people with lower incomes rated environmental problems as more severe than others, were more willing to spend federal funds to solve them, and were consistent in their ratingsof severity of environmental problems and their willingness to spend federal funds. Cleaning up LANL and other Department of Energy sites, received the highest rating for expenditure of federal funds. The highest rated future uses for DOE sites were for recreation and for National Environmental Research Parks. People with less education generally gave higher ratings to mostfuture land uses for DOE than did those with more education. However, those with higher education gave higher ratings to nuclear reprocessing, and nuclear material storage. Where there were differences, the people interviewed at Santa Fe rated all environmental problems (except pesticides) as more severe than did those previously interviewed in Albuquerque (located fartherfrom the LANL site), and they were more willing to spend federalfunds on these problems. Ratings for all future land uses did notdiffer between the Santa Fe and Albuquerque respondents. These perception-based indicators show general agreement among peopleliving close and farther away from LANL with respect to cleaningup LANL and the future land uses for the site. These indicators should be considered by regulators, site personnel, and policy makers in future management and land use decisions.  相似文献

Understanding Managers’ Views of Global Environmental Risk   总被引:1,自引:0,他引:1  
This research investigated managers’ views of two global environmental risks: climate change and loss of biodiversity. The intent was to understand why different managers place varying levels of attention and priority on these issues. The data came from in-depth interviews with 28 senior corporate managers across Canada and a range of sectors, although most were employed in the energy sector. Approximately half had direct environmental responsibilities and half had other management duties. Grounded theory was used to collect and analyze the data. From the results, a theoretical framework was constructed to explain important factors that can influence managers’ mental models of environmental risk. Four factors relevant to managers’ appraisal of the threat of environmental risk include: (1) salience, (2) intrinsic value of nature, (3) knowledge, and (4) perceived resilience of nature. In addition, four factors relevant to managers’ view of the appeal of a particular response strategy were: (1) avoidability, (2) perceived costs and benefits, (3) fairness and equity, and (4) effectiveness. The time horizon for decision making was seen as being important in both portions of the mental model.  相似文献

This paper characterizes the emission rates of size fractionated particulate matter, inorganic aerosols, acid gases, ammonia and methane measured over four flocks at a commercial broiler chicken facility. Mean emission rates of each pollutant, along with sampling notes, were reported in this paper, the first in a series of two. Sampling notes were needed because inherent gaps in data may bias the mean emission rates.The mean emission rates of PM10 and PM2.5 were 5.0 and 0.78 g day?1 [Animal Unit, AU]?1, respectively, while inorganic aerosols mean emission rates ranged from 0.15 to 0.46 g day?1 AU?1 depending on the season. The average total acid gas emission rate was 0.43 g day?1 AU?1 with the greatest contribution from nitrous and nitric acids and little contribution from sulfuric acid (as SO2).Ammonia emissions were seasonally dependent, with a mean emission rate of 66.0 g day?1 AU?1 in the cooler seasons and 94.5 g day?1 AU?1 during the warmer seasons. Methane emissions were relatively consistent with a mean emission rate of 208 g day?1 AU?1.The diurnal pattern in each pollutant’s emission rate was relatively consistent after normalizing the hourly emissions according to each daily mean emission rate. Over the duration of a production cycle, all the measured pollutants’ emissions increased proportionally to the total live mass of birds in the house, with the exception of ammonia.Interrelationships between pollutants provide evidence of mutually dependent release mechanisms, which suggests that it may be possible to fill data gaps with minimal data requirements. To date, sparse information is available on the mechanical properties of municipal solid waste and the results of published work are often hard to compare due to differences in waste composition and therefore properties. To allow comparison, a unified classification system for waste is deemed crucial. Existing classification systems are presented and discussed. For a geotechnical classification, mechanical properties, size, shape and degradability potential of waste components have to be taken into account. A new and improved classification system for waste components is proposed, which complies with the requirements of a geotechnical classification system. It classifies waste components based on: (1) their material engineering properties (e.g., shear, compressive and tensile strength), (2) a size distribution of the components, (3) the component shape (reinforcing, compressible and incompressible), and (4) the degree of degradability. The proposed classification system is applied to data from the literature and methods for presenting classification information are demonstrated. Further work required to develop a full classification system for waste bodies is highlighted.  相似文献

Dislocating identity: Desegregation and the transformation of place   总被引:2,自引:0,他引:2  
Whatever other changes it engenders, desegregation invariably produces a re-organization of space and place, a fact whose implications the psychological literature on the process has generally disregarded. The present article begins to address this gap. Drawing on research on place–identity processes, we argue that desegregation may alter not only the relationship between self and other, but also the relationship between self and place. As such, it may be experienced as a form of dislocation: an event that undermines shared constructions of place and the forms of located subjectivity they sustain. In order to develop this idea, we analyse a series of interviews conducted with holiday-makers on a formerly white but now multiracial beach in South Africa. The analysis demonstrates how white respondents’ stories of desegregation evince an abiding concern with the loss of place, manifest in terms of an erosion of a sense of place belonging, attachment and familiarity and an undermining of the beach's capacity to act as a restorative environment of the self. The implications of such accounts for understanding personal and ideological resistance to desegregation are explored. The paper concludes by arguing that this problem provides an opportunity to conjoin environmental and social psychological work.  相似文献
